#24bcd9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24bcd9 is composed of 14.1% red, 73.7%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.4%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 189.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.5% and a lightness of 49.6%. #24bcd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#0079b3.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#24bcd9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#24bcd9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8081 is the less saturated color, while #07d0f6 is the most saturated one.
